A new kosher concept has opened in Midtown Manhattan, operating fully as a delivery- and pickup-only ghost kitchen. Cattle, located at 245 W 46th Street, is positioned in the heart of the Theater District, steps from Times Square. With no dine-in service and a menu built for transport, the kitchen focuses on delivering a steady supply of Glatt Kosher smoked meats and burgers to one of the busiest areas of the city.

A Smokehouse Designed for Delivery

Cattle emphasizes “real wood smoked and charcoal grilled” preparation across its menu. The ghost-kitchen model allows the team to streamline production around delivery orders, ensuring consistent quality without the space or staffing needs of a traditional dining room. Midtown’s dense mix of office workers, theatergoers and tourists creates strong demand for fast, reliable kosher meal options, and Cattle aims to fill that gap with a meat-forward lineup that packs and travels well.

Menu Overview

The menu is built around smoked meats, quarter-pound burgers and ten-inch sandwiches, all prepared with delivery in mind. Highlights include:

Smoked Brisket Meal with a half-pound of 18-hour smoked brisket and a choice of side

Shaved Juicy Ribeye Meal featuring marinated and grilled ribeye slices

Smoked Beef Bacon Strips Meal prepared with house-cured, maple-glazed beef bacon

The burger selection includes:

Heritage Burger, topped with parve cheddar, smoked beef bacon, house barbecue sauce, caramelized onion and truffle sauce, with a drink included

Loaded with Brisket Burger, combining a quarter-pound patty with smoked brisket, slaw, pickles and sweet onion sauce, with a drink included

Sandwiches include:

Cattle’s Brisket Sandwich with smoked brisket slices, garlic sauce, a touch of barbecue and caramelized onion on a ten-inch baguette

Shaved Ribeye Sandwich layered with chimichurri ribeye, sweet onion sauce, grilled onion and pickled jalapeño

This menu places smoked brisket, ribeye and beef bacon at the center, aligning with the restaurant’s smokehouse identity while keeping offerings fully Glatt Kosher.

Serving the Theater District and Times Square

Situated on West 46th Street, Cattle is positioned deep in the Theater District. This spot places it within minutes of Broadway venues, hotels and tourist foot traffic. Since many kosher diners in the area need quick, dependable options before or after shows, a ghost kitchen offering smoked meats and burgers provides a practical alternative to traditional restaurants.

Because the kitchen focuses entirely on off-premise dining, all items are engineered for delivery flow. Packaging, portion sizes and toppings are selected to hold structure and flavor through transit, which is essential for both locals and visitors ordering from nearby hotels.
